After low-scoring totals in their previous five contests, Glendora brought some dynamite into their most recent contest. They never let the Diamond Bar Brahmas get on the board and left with a 13-0 victory on Tuesday. The win was some much needed relief for the Tartans as it spelled an end to their three-game losing streak.

Not much got past Brayden Johnson, who gave up just a hit and racked up 13 Ks to keep Diamond Bar off the board. Johnson also tossed no earned runs, which is notable because Glendora is 4-2 when he allows at most three earned runs, but 3-4 otherwise.

On the hitting side, Kai Zeits was a standout: he scored two runs while going 2-for-4. Glendora is undefeated when Zeits posts two or more runs, but 4-6 otherwise. Another player making a difference was Santiago Garza, who went 1-for-3 with two runs, one triple, and one RBI.

Zeits wasn't the only one working in the hit department: Glendora kept the outfield on their toes and finished the game with 14 hits. Glendora is 3-1 when they post 11 or more hits.

Glendora's victory was their first in the league, bumping their league record up to 1-3 and their overall record up to 7-6. As for Diamond Bar, they are on an eight-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 2-11.

Glendora will have a chance to go back-to-back against Diamond Bar: the pair's next game is a rematch scheduled at 3:30 p.m. on Thursday.
